Global Adaptive Traffic Control System Market – Introduction

  • An adaptive traffic control system is a process by which the timing of a traffic signal is continuously adjusted based on the traffic at intersections. Moreover, adaptive traffic control systems provide a fixed timing for green signal at each intersection and update the anticipated arrivals for adjacent intersections. Additionally, as arrival patterns change from time to time, the timing for green signal at each intersection also changes.
  • An adaptive traffic control system first collects data from sensors and, then, the data is evaluated and signal timing is allocated. Finally, the adaptive system is integrated with signal timing updates and performance is evaluated through remote monitoring. After this, the same process is repeated continuously by using internal hardware and software. Moreover, these systems share information with each other and make necessary adjustments to signal timing parameters for reducing traffic jam issues.
  • Adaptive traffic control systems improve the travel time reliability by progressively moving vehicles through green lights and reduce traffic congestion by creating smoother flow. Moreover, it also reduces excess fuel consumption and wastage of time. However, the traditional signal timing design and maintenance is labor intensive and it leads to high maintenance costs as well as less durability. Use of adaptive traffic control systems has overcome issues associated with traditional signal systems and has provided an automated process.
  • Adaptive traffic control systems use the real-time traffic data and adjust the signal timing accordingly. Moreover, it tracks various events that cannot be anticipated with the traditional signal systems, such as accidents and road construction activities. It maximizes the capacity of the existing systems. This, in turn, reduces operational costs for both system users and operating agencies. Additionally, it can also help in decreasing the level of emissions of carbon monoxide and hydrocarbons by smoothening the traffic flow.

Global Adaptive Traffic Control System Market – Dynamics

Increasing Traffic and Government Initiatives to Boost Global Adaptive Traffic Control System Market

  • Increasing traffic congestion year by year has caused increase in air pollution, waste of time and productivity, and various respiratory diseases. Furthermore, the cost of resolving traffic congestion is high. Governments are also taking initiatives for traffic management and promoting the PPP (public–private partnership) working model. Moreover, growing population and increasing purchasing power of consumers are leading to rise in traffic jams. In order to overcome this issue, adaptive traffic control systems are required.

Increase in Security Issues and Lack of Standardized and Uniform Technologies to Hamper Global Adaptive Traffic Control System Market

  • Government and enterprises are adopting advance technologies such as machine learning, artificial intelligence and internet of things (IoT) for simplifying their processes and reduce human intervention. However, chances of security breach are increasing due to digitization of processes. This is estimated to adversely affect the global adaptive traffic control system market during the forecast period. Additionally, lack of standardized and uniform technologies is likely to hamper the global adaptive traffic control system market in the near future.
